Never in its history Mexican GP in F1 a Mexican driver managed to win the career. Pedro Rodríguez came close in 1968, but no one had more options than them Checo Pérez, who in 2023 part as one of the favorites to succeed in Autodrome Hermanos Rodríguez.
The Guadalajara native will not have it easy as he will have to outplay his teammate, Max Verstappenwho has won 15 of the 18 races of the season and the last two in Mexico.
